A beautiful waterfront. A great place to spend some time if you have some time to burn. Places to shop and eat. Plenty of delicious food and cool trinkets. Also a really pretty lighthouse to view and take photos of. Plenty of parking in the area and it's easy to get to and from. You can park and walk around on all of the paths without difficulty. I definetly recommend stopping by if you're in the area.

A fun little boardwalk with a bunch of shops, we went to quite a few. My favourites were crystal mist, vintage and get caked doughnuts. More touristy than for locals but still fun. And you can also sit and relax too enjoy the views and chill. There’s something for everyone. Including a big stage with a wheel I assume they do theatre acts at. Will definitely be returning if I’m over there.
